A convenient form for the Microsoft Ecosystem

Overall, for our basic needs, MS Forms is perfect for internal polls, surveys, and quizzes.

PROS

I like that the forms are easy to use within the Microsoft ecosystem, our team uses MS 365. The forms are intuitive enough and can be customized to fit basic surveys, polls, and even quizzes.

CONS

It does have limits like being unable to capture e-signatures natively (I think there is a separate integration for this).

Reasons for switching to Microsoft Forms

We used to be with Google Workspace, so when we transitioned to MS 365, we switched this one too. We still use Google Forms for our website, because we want to keep MS Forms within our company's use.

Forms, great for polling, not the best for grading higher level thinking problems

Overall, I think it is a great product for formative assessments and surveying. I use it in my high school classroom often.

PROS

The real-time graphs and pie charts are great for polling and surveys for my students. Having a QR code makes completing the Form very easy.

CONS

I often give students question where they have to show equations, work, or write in sentences. Other online assessment tools allow me to grade those types of answers on wifi, in real time. Forms makes you download an excel, take up space on your device, and then it isn't in real time. I would also suggest that you allow us to customize the link right on your platform. Your links are absurdly long and I have to use an outside website to shorten it.
